This grant aims to support breakthrough innovation in the implementation of the European Water Resilience Strategy, contributing to the restoration of the water cycle, fostering a water-smart economy, ensuring the EU water industry’s competitiveness, and providing clean and affordable water for all. Proposals should demonstrate, test, or validate innovative tools and solutions, apply a multi-actor approach, and involve relevant stakeholders such as farmers, water-intensive industries, energy producers, land managers, water governance bodies, and local authorities. Projects should consider and potentially expand on the results of previous national or EU-funded research, avoid duplication, and promote future uptake and upscaling at various levels. Actions may address water retention in ecosystems, preparedness against water scarcity and floods, water efficiency across sectors, innovative water pricing, circular water use, public engagement in water resource management, equitable access to water, and methodologies for water footprint management. Collaboration among awarded projects and leveraging Copernicus and Galileo/EGNOS data is encouraged.
